Practical checks for readers
Before acting on any slot app, free play or APK-related claim, readers should separate learning information from trust information. Learning information includes RTP, volatility, paylines, symbols and paytable rules. Trust information includes source identity, publisher details, update notes, privacy policy, requested permissions, complaint patterns and local-rule context.
This distinction matters because a page can describe slot mechanics correctly while still making weak or unsupported claims about bonuses, withdrawals or app safety. FS Slot articles should help readers slow down, compare details and avoid treating screenshots or promotional wording as proof.

Common mistakes to avoid
The most common mistake is trusting a page because it uses a known app name, a 777 image or the phrase latest version. Another mistake is assuming free play results predict future results. A third mistake is accepting every permission request quickly without asking whether that permission matches the app features.
Readers should also be careful with urgent download buttons, short links, missing publisher details and pages that connect free play with guaranteed outcomes. Helpful content should explain what can be checked and what remains uncertain.

Reader example: how to apply the checklist
Imagine a reader finds a slot app page through search or a shared link. The page may show a familiar name, a colorful reel image and words about free play or fast access. The reader should not stop at the headline. A safer process is to read the page title, inspect the source, compare version details, review permissions and look for policy information before deciding what the page actually proves.
If the page is only about learning, the reader can stay with demo play and slot terminology. If the page asks for installation, the reader should move to APK Safety checks. If the page includes bonus, withdrawal or real-money wording, the reader should treat it as a claim that needs terms, eligibility details and local-rule context.
